# Weekly Cash-Box Run

Every Friday morning, the petty-cash box from the Millbrent office heads over to the central counting room at Harrowgate House. It's a small grey strongbox, sealed with a numbered tag, and it always travels with the regular courier on the 10:15 loop. Dispatch logs the tag number before it leaves and the counting room confirms on arrival. Nothing fancy, just keep it consistent. When the courier shows up, relay this instruction verbatim:

courier memo of bawig-kahap: the casath ralmir courier leaves the norok weniel norok druvan frador ulaiel belix druael ledger at gate 3981 under passcode 761393

- [ ] Step 7: Archive cold storage buckets (Glacierline tier). Confirm both ceremony witnesses are present, verify bucket manifests match the Oxbow ledger, then seal the archive key shares. Plugin authors may observe but not handle shares. Once sealed, the archive index itself is encrypted and can only be reopened with the passphrase below.

vault phrase of badup-hahig = tamael-aldael-kelmir-istael-fenok-istwyn-tamius-jorath-oliion

Action item from the Harkwell repo incident: the stale-branch cleanup bot deleted two protected release branches because the protection check ran against a cached branch list. The fix adds a live verification call before any delete, plus a dry-run report reviewed daily for one sprint. Security reviewers should confirm the bot's token is scoped to delete only branches matching the stale-* pattern. The bot's permission model and verification logic are documented on the page below.

operations page: https://jenkins.zemvarcloud.local/job/merge_requests/repo/build/73930b4b30f0a8ed

The legacy Quillhopper job queue has been fully replaced by the Drossel Dispatch API, which enforces per-tenant rate limits and signs every enqueue request with an HMAC derived from the caller's service identity. All dispatch endpoints require TLS 1.3 and reject unauthenticated traffic at the gateway. During the migration window, the shim service at Fennwick relays legacy calls through the new authorization layer. For security review purposes, the credential used by the shim is reproduced below.

service key, fawip-bajef: kto11_Qt5wZK9vdNC